背景 在移動端頁面中,由於屏幕空間有限,導航條扮演着非常重要的角色,提供了快速導航到不同頁面或功能的方式。用户也通常會在導航條中尋找他們感興趣的內容,因此導航條的曝光率較高。在這樣的背景下,提供一個動態靈活的導航條,為產品賦能,變得尤其重要。 使用原生導航欄現狀 拿iOS原生導航條為例,導航條作為頁面進出棧的根視圖連接器,以及生命週期的管理器。尤其是在作為webView Controller的父容
文章和代碼已經歸檔至【Github倉庫:https://github.com/timerring/dive-into-AI 】或者公眾號【AIShareLab】回覆 R語言 也可獲取。 在實際的問題中,數據分析者面對的可能是有幾十萬條記錄、幾百個變量的數據集。處理這種大型的數據集需要消耗計算機比較大的內存空間,所以儘可能使用 64 位的操作系統和內存比較大的設備。否則,數據分析可能要花太長時
作者:vivo 互聯網服務器團隊 - Liu Zhen、Ye Wenhao 服務器內存問題是影響應用程序性能和穩定性的重要因素之一,需要及時排查和優化。本文介紹了某核心服務內存問題排查與解決過程。首先在JVM與大對象優化上進行了有效的實踐,其次在故障轉移與大對象監控上提出了可靠的落地方案。最後,總結了內存優化需要考慮的其他問題。 一、問題描述 音樂業務中,core服務主要提供歌曲、歌手等元數據與用
前言 歡迎關注同名公眾號《熊的貓》,文章會同步更新,也可快速加入前端交流羣! H5 移動端 開發的必不可少的一個環節就是 移動端網頁的適配,因為 UI 通常只會提供 大小固定的設計稿,而各種不同移動設備具有不同的頁面分辨率和大小,所以適配的目的就是讓一份設計稿在不同移動設備上表現出一致性。 雖然現如今各種插件都可以幫助我們快速配置完成,例如 lib-flexible、postcss-pxto
網絡 檢查4G網絡步驟 確認4G天線是否安裝正確 確認SIM卡狀態是否正常 輸入sudo busybox microcom /dev/ttyUSB2,輸入at,如果返回值是OK代表模塊識別正常 輸入at+csq查看信號強度,第一個值為99説明沒有信號 輸入at+qsimstat=1,at+qsimstat?查看sim卡狀態,第二位為1説明SIM已經準備完畢 4G模組重啓 raspi-
使用 Serverless 構建獨立站的優勢 在傳統架構模式下,如果需要進行電商大促需要提前預置計算資源以支撐高併發訪問,會造成計算資源浪費並且增加運維工作量。本文介紹一種新的部署方式,將 WordPress 和 WooCommerce 部署在 Amazon Lambda 中。Lambda 是無服務器的計算方式,無需預置資源就可以運行代碼,自動響應任何規模的代碼執行請求,從每天十幾個事件到每秒數十
在 c++ 面向對象使用中,我們常常會定義一個基類類型的指針,在運行過程中,這個指針可能指向一個基類類型的對象,也可能指向的是其子類類型的對象,那現在問題來了,我們如何去判斷這個指針到底執行了一個什麼類型的對象呢? ![上傳中...]() 今天我們就聊一下這個問題,首先我們要區分是否允許 RTTI,據此有不同辦法。 1 允許使用 RTTI 在打開 rtti 的場景下,可以使用 dyna
文章和代碼已經歸檔至【Github倉庫:https://github.com/timerring/dive-into-AI 】或者公眾號【AIShareLab】回覆 R語言 也可獲取。 缺失值處理 在實際的數據分析中,缺失數據是常常遇到的。缺失值(missing values)通常是由於沒有收集到數據或者沒有錄入數據。 例如,年齡的缺失可能是由於某人沒有提供他(她)的年齡。大部分統計分析方法
引言 在create-react-app項目中配置絕對單位px轉換為相對單位rem,其中使用postcss-plugin-px2rem轉換css/less/sass文件(此插件不支持內聯樣式轉換),使用編寫的loader轉換內聯樣式 1.安裝插件 npm i postcss-plugin-px2rem 2.配置webpack 1 找到config/webpack.config.js裏po
文章和代碼已經歸檔至【Github倉庫:https://github.com/timerring/dive-into-AI 】或者公眾號【AIShareLab】回覆 R語言 也可獲取。 有時數據集來自多個地方,我們需要將兩個或多個數據集合併成一個數據集。合併數據框的操作包括縱向合併、橫向合併和按照某個共有變量合併。 1.縱向合併:rbind( ) 要縱向合併兩個數據框,可以使用 rbind(
先把二叉樹的四種遍歷模式和結果記錄下來,然後倒推各種解法,如下圖所示: 4種遍歷模式的順序 前序遍歷:根、左、右 中序遍歷:左、根、右 後序遍歷:左、右、根 層次遍歷:一層一層遍歷 4種遍歷模式及結果如下 前序遍歷:1 2 4 5 7 8 3 6 中序遍歷:4 2 7 5 8 1 3 6 後序遍歷:4 7 8 5 2 6 3 1 層次遍歷:1 2 3 4 5 6 7
n9e=nightingale n9e監控告警框架,提供了監控繪圖、監控告警以及通知等一體的監控運維體系,在雲原生時代,可以認為是Open-falcon的升級版。 一. 告警的數據流 指標存儲:使用push模式 categraf採集後push給n9e-server; n9e-server將指標值push給時序庫prometheus; 指標告警:使用pull模式 由n9e-server使
一輪互聯網寒冬席捲肆虐後,不少程序員的求職步入了地獄模式。在這樣的形勢下,與其盲目投遞簡歷,不如去把握市場需求的技能方向,提前做好準備更有實效。 如果你所掌握的編程技能在市場中屬需求量大的那類,自然不必擔心找不着工作;反之,你就需要好好考慮下自己未來的職業發展路線了,是選擇轉行,還是學習新的編程語言繼續在編程行業混飯吃。無論你是上面的哪種,下面這篇文章都能對你有所幫助。 那麼接下來,這篇文章將總結
今天想和小夥伴們聊一下我們在使用 Spring AOP 時,一個非常常見的概念 AspectJ。 1. 關於代理 小夥伴們知道,Java 23 種設計模式中有一種模式叫做代理模式,這種代理我們可以將之稱為靜態代理,Spring AOP 我們常説是一種動態代理,那麼這兩種代理的區別在哪裏呢? 1.1 靜態代理 這種代理在我們日常生活中其實非常常見,例如房屋中介就相當於是一個代理,當房東需要出租房子的
文章和代碼已經歸檔至【Github倉庫:https://github.com/timerring/dive-into-AI 】或者公眾號【AIShareLab】回覆 R語言 也可獲取。 這個包以一種統一的規範更高效地處理數據框。dplyr 包裏處理數據框的所有函數的第一個參數都是數據框名。 下面以 MASS 包裏的 birthwt 數據集為例,介紹 dplyr 包裏常用函數的用法。該數據集來
參考資料: react-native-webview-tencentx5 手把手教你一步步集成騰訊 X5 內核(Tencent TBS X5) 接入文檔 開發文檔 之前基於react-native-webview封裝的Canvas在比較老的android手機上沒法導出圖片canvas.toDataURL失效了,就想用react-native-webview-tencentx
時隔兩年,Pika 社區正式發佈經由社區 50 多人蔘與開發並在 360 生產環境驗證可用的 v3.5.0 版本,新版本在提升性能的同時,也支持了 Codis 集羣部署,BlobDB KV 分離,增加 Exporter 等新特性。 我們將詳細介紹該版本引入的重要新特性。 1 去除 Rsync 在 v3.5.0 版本之前,Pika 使用 Rsync 工具進行引擎中存量數據的同步,Pika 進程啓動時
文章和代碼已經歸檔至【Github倉庫:https://github.com/timerring/dive-into-AI 】或者公眾號【AIShareLab】回覆 R語言 也可獲取。 用 R 基本包 在實際的數據分析中,分析者往往需要花費大量的精力在數據的準備上,將數據轉換為分析所需要的形式。遺憾的是,大多數統計學教材很少涉及這一重要問題。整理數據是統計學的任務之一。我們開始關注 R 中最
作者 | 我愛吃海米 導讀 移動端開發中,IO密集問題在很多時候沒有得到充足的重視和解決,貿然的把IO導致的卡頓放到異步線程,可能會導致真正的問題被掩蓋,前人挖坑後人踩。其實首先要想的是,數據存儲方式是否合理,數據的使用方式是否合理。本文介紹度加剪輯對MMKV的使用和優化。 全文14813字,預計閲讀時間38分鐘。 01 一切皆文件-移動端IO介紹 移動端的App程序很多情況是IO密集型
1. 聚水潭用户使用場景:電商行業通常使用聚水潭作為企業的ERP系統。每當聚水潭有新的售後申請時,企業人員常常需要將訂單信息手動複製並錄入到夥伴雲存儲、彙總,包括訂單單號、狀態、金額等20多項信息。這種人工手動複製和錄入的方式容易導致訂單數據出現偏差,例如信息多添、少添等問題,這將不利於訂單的後期維護。 因此,商家希望能夠實現該流程的自動化。如果要連接兩個不同系統的數據,往往需要系統開發,費用高,
1. 聚水潭用户使用場景:電商行業通常使用聚水潭作為企業的ERP系統。然而,每當聚水潭產生新訂單時,企業人員常常需要將訂單信息手動複製並錄入到夥伴雲存儲、彙總,包括訂單單號、狀態、金額等20多項信息。 這種人工手動複製和錄入的方式容易導致訂單數據出現偏差,例如信息多添、少添等問題,這將不利於訂單的後期維護。因此,商家希望能夠實現該流程的自動化。 如果要連接兩個不同系統的數據,往往需要系統開發,費用
集簡雲平台內置大量自動化流程模板,用户可以在“模板中心”搜索應用名稱,選擇適合自己的場景,直接使用。 本期分享CRM系統自動化工作流程。 模板推薦模板1:小鵝通新增訂單後同步到SeaTable並更新微伴助手用户信息 集成應用:小鵝通 + SeaTable + 企業微信羣機器人 使用場景小鵝通當有新訂單支付時,查詢用户信息並同步到SeaTable新增數據,企業微信羣機器人發送文本消息到對應的企業微
品牌故事 車鄰邦成立於2009年,專注於汽車貼膜及美容裝飾服務,核心業務是為高端4S店、4S集團提供汽車精品領域“產品+營銷+施工+售後”的一站式解決方案。公司成立至今已有14年之久,累計服務客户數百家、累計服務車輛百萬台次,口碑極佳。曾被美國威固品牌授予公司榮譽包括:2020年最佳合作伙伴獎、2019年到2016年威固爭霸賽全國冠軍,2015年度威固中國PDI金牌服務商等多次嘉獎。 遇到的問題
協議介紹 gRPC 是谷歌開源的一套 RPC 協議框架,底層使用HTTP/2協議,主要有兩部分,數據編碼以及請求映射 數據編碼是將內存對象編碼為可傳輸的字節流,也包括把字節流轉化為內存對象,常見的包含json, msgpack, xml, protobuf,其中該編碼效率比json高一些,grpc選擇使用protobuf gRPC為什麼基於HTTP2 HTTP1.1遇到的問題 協議繁瑣,包含很